sb. pl. Obs. [OE. eorþware, f. eorþe, EARTH sb.1 + -ware, as in heofonware heaven-dwellers, burhware, etc.] Earth-dwellers.
c. 893. K. Ælfred, Oros., III. v. § 5. Crist sibb is heofonwara and eorðwara.
c. 1175. Lamb. Hom., 139. Sunne dei blisseð to-gederes houeneware and horðe ware.
a. 1225. Ancr. R., 322. Al þe wide worldeeorðe ware and heouene ware.
